How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Actually Works
When you call our team for Clean Water Extraction (Category 1), we’ll send a certified technician to assess the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ry out your property. Our process involves several key steps to ensure a thorough and safe extraction.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technician will evaluate the extent of the damage, identify the source of the water, and create a plan to extract the water and dry out your property.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to remove standing water from your property, including wet/dry vacuums and pumps. This step is critical in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ry out your property, including air movers and dehumidifiers. This step is essential in preventing mold growth and ensuring your property is safe to occupy.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We’ll use specialized equipment to sanitize and disinfect your property, ensuring it’s safe to occupy. This step is critical in preventing the growth of bacteria and other microorganisms.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Our technician will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is safe to occupy and free of any remaining water or debris. This step is essential in ensuring your property is restored to its original condition.

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standing water is less than 1 inch deep | Yes | No | You can use wet/dry vacuums or pumps to extract the water yourself. |
| Water has seeped into walls or ceilings | No | Yes | Water in walls or ceilings need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ract safely. |
| Flooding is caused by a burst pipe | No | Yes | Burst pipes need immediate attention to prevent further damage and ensure safety. |
| Water damage is extensive or widespread | No | Yes | Extensive or widespread water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ract safely and effectively. |
| You’re unsure about the extent of the damage | No | Yes | It’s always better to err on the side of caution and call a professional to assess the damage and create a plan for extraction. |
While some minor water damage can be handled DIY, it’s essential to call a professional for more extensive or complex issues. Our team has the expertise and equipment to handle any water damage situation, ensuring your property is safe and restored to its original condition.
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Cost In Eatonton, GA
The cost of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) in Eatonton, GA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on industry standards and may vary dep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Planning |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and complexity of the issue |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of personnel required |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of personnel required |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of personnel required |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of personnel required |
